Itens

No universo da análise de dados com Python, a biblioteca Pandas se destaca como uma das ferramentas mais poderosas e versáteis. Entre seus componentes fundamentais, encontramos a Pandas Series, um objeto que facilita a manipulação e análise de dados de forma eficiente e intuitiva. Entender o que é uma Pandas Series é essencial para qualquer pessoa que deseja trabalhar com dados estruturados em Python, pois ela serve como base para estruturas mais complexas, como os DataFrames.

Introdução ao Pandas Series: Conceitos Básicos

A Pandas Series pode ser entendida como uma estrutura de dados unidimensional, semelhante a uma lista ou array, mas com funcionalidades muito mais avançadas. Ela armazena uma sequência de valores, todos do mesmo tipo, e cada valor é associado a um índice, que pode ser numérico ou rotulado com nomes personalizados. Essa característica permite que você acesse os dados de forma rápida e direta, seja pelo índice numérico padrão ou por um rótulo específico que faça sentido no contexto dos dados.

Além disso, a Pandas Series oferece uma série de métodos integrados para manipulação, análise e transformação dos dados armazenados. Isso inclui operações matemáticas, estatísticas, filtragem e até mesmo o tratamento de valores ausentes. Por ser uma estrutura otimizada, a Series é capaz de lidar com grandes volumes de dados com eficiência, tornando-se uma escolha ideal para tarefas que exigem rapidez e flexibilidade.

Outro ponto importante é que a Pandas Series serve como a base para outras estruturas mais complexas dentro da biblioteca Pandas, como os DataFrames, que são essencialmente coleções de Series alinhadas por índice. Portanto, compreender a Series é o primeiro passo para dominar o trabalho com dados em Pandas e, consequentemente, em Python.

Como Criar e Manipular uma Pandas Series em Python

Criar uma Pandas Series em Python é um processo simples e direto. Para isso, basta importar a biblioteca Pandas e utilizar a função pd.Series(), passando uma lista, array ou até mesmo um dicionário como argumento. Por exemplo, você pode criar uma Series a partir de uma lista de números inteiros ou de uma lista de strings, e opcionalmente definir um índice personalizado para facilitar o acesso aos dados.

Manipular uma Series envolve diversas operações que podem ser feitas de maneira intuitiva. Você pode acessar elementos individuais usando o índice, fazer fatias, aplicar funções matemáticas diretamente sobre os dados, ou até mesmo filtrar a Series com base em condições específicas. Além disso, é possível alterar os valores, renomear índices, e até combinar duas ou mais Series para criar novas estruturas de dados.

Outro aspecto importante é o tratamento de dados faltantes, que é comum em análises do mundo real. A Pandas Series oferece métodos para identificar, preencher ou remover esses valores ausentes, garantindo que a análise seja feita de forma mais precisa e confiável. Com essas funcionalidades, a Series se torna uma ferramenta indispensável para quem trabalha com dados em Python.

A Pandas Series é uma estrutura fundamental para a manipulação de dados em Python, combinando simplicidade e poder em uma interface amigável. Seu uso facilita desde tarefas básicas, como armazenar listas de valores, até operações complexas de análise e transformação de dados. Ao dominar a criação e manipulação das Series, você abre portas para explorar todo o potencial da biblioteca Pandas e aprimorar suas habilidades em ciência de dados.

Seja para iniciantes ou para profissionais experientes, entender o que é uma Pandas Series e como utilizá-la é um passo crucial para trabalhar de forma eficiente com dados estruturados. Com a prática, você perceberá que essa ferramenta é não apenas versátil, mas também indispensável no cotidiano de quem lida com grandes volumes de informações. Portanto, investir tempo em aprender sobre Pandas Series certamente trará muitos benefícios para sua jornada no mundo da análise de dados.

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*